Samúel Guðmundsson has received several threats from Israelis after a video showing him confronting American Rabbi Jacob Shmuley Boteach spread rapidly online, mbl.is reports.

Guðmundsson appeared with Boteach on British broadcaster Piers Morgan’s programme Uncensored, which aired on Thursday evening. The two engaged in a heated argument during the programme.

The video was recorded in Akureyri, where Guðmundsson approached Boteach and said, “Fuck Israel and fuck genocide,” referring to the ongoing conflict between Israel and Palestinians in Gaza.

Boteach reacted angrily to the remarks, followed Guðmundsson and his girlfriend through the streets of Akureyri with a camera, and accused him of antisemitism.

“Several Israelis have sent threats. One sent a message to my girlfriend saying he intended to find out where she and her family lived,” Guðmundsson told mbl.is.

He said he had tried to avoid reading comments on social media, although most of what he had seen had been positive. He also thanked people around the world, and especially fellow Icelanders, for their support.

Guðmundsson said Boteach was unhappy with him and had wished him harm on his own social media accounts. He added that he was pleased with how Morgan challenged the rabbi during the programme.

Looking ahead, Guðmundsson said he was keeping his options open and had plenty of strong opinions if people wanted to hear more from him. He said the main priority was to draw attention to the issue, which he described as a terrible situation for the victims of Israel.

He said opposition to what he called the genocide had brought people together across the political spectrum, including many right-wing people of his age. Guðmundsson said he would not normally be classified as left-wing, but that the issue had united people and shown the best in them.
